It does vary somewhat based on heat, track configurations, and track surface but I typically get 8-10 days from a set of NT-01 before they cord. I swap L>R if running the same track multiple days and mount tires based on anticipated wear for the day.

I have run a bunch of different track tires over the years but NT-01 are still among my top 3 favorites after shredding about 20 sets. A good DE/TT tire that is predictable and manages heat well. RS4s last longer and are better in rain but are not as good dry grip wise. RE-71r seem to be just as fast but don't like heat and are gone in 4-5 days.
